How Far From Paulins Kill to ...
We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Paulins Kill to various places of note, such as the White House.
With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ance<3> beginning in Paulins Kill and extending to:
- Newton, which is the Seat of Sussex County, lies just to the East.
- Trenton, which is the State Capital of New Jersey, lies 57 miles [91.7 km]<3> to the south (S). If you could walk a straight line from Paulins Kill to Trenton, with an average speed<4>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take most of three days to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take over two days.
- The White House (Washington, DC) is 189 miles [304.2 km] to the southwest (SW).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take a little over three hours, a buggy would take 8 days and walking would take 11 days.
- The shortest distance<5> to Jerusalem (specifically the Temple Mount and the Dome of the Rock) is 5,714 miles [9,195.8 km] and it lies to the northeast (NE).<6>
- The distance to the Great Mosque of Mecca (specifically the Ka'bah - or Kaaba ) is 6,423 miles [10,336.8 km] and it lies to the east northeast (ENE).<7>
- The distance to Saint Peter's Basilica (The Vatican) is 4,299 miles [6,918.6 km] and it lies to the east northeast (ENE).<8>

<5> | The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Paulins Kill to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East. |
